Oxy 'out of Shah race'



By Upstream staff 

Occidental Petroleum has been advised by Abu Dhabi's national oil company that it has not been selected to develop sour gas reserves at the Shah field in the United Arab Emirates, reports said.

ConocoPhillips, Shell and ExxonMobil are in the running for the multibillion-dollar project.

Record oil revenues have fueled economic expansion and boosted demand for gas from the power sector and from heavy industry in the United Arab Emirates, reuters said.

Abu Dhabi's national oil company had been expected to name a partner at the field by the end of 2007.
